Heat the oil in a cast-iron skillet over medium heat. Add the onion and saute 5-6 mins til onion is soft, add the garlic and cook a further minute.
Add the ground beef and cook 4-5 mins until no longer pink.
Add the pasta sauce and Italian Seasoning and simmer, stirring occasionally around 5-6 mins.
Season with salt and pepper to taste.
Assembly
Transfer 2/3 of the meat sauce to a bowl, leaving 1/3 the sauce in the skillet
Lay half the noodles over the sauce in the skillet, spoon half the cottage cheese mixture over the noodles, sprinkle 1/2 cup of mozzarella, then repeat with sauce, noodles, cottage cheese,1/2 cup mozzarella and last 1/3 of the sauce.
Bake
Cover the pan tightly with foil and bake until the noodles are tender, 25 to 30 mins.
Remove from the oven, and let it rest a few minutes - broiling the top if desired.
To serve
Garnish with chopped parsley or fresh basil.

Substitutions:
It's easy to change this up and make a different flavored lasagna for each night of the week! Use what you have, it will be MARVELOUS, I promise!
Sub the cottage cheese for ricotta.
Use no-boil lasagna noodles instead of regular - cook for less time!
Use different flavored tomato sauce. I like a four-cheese pasta sauce, but your favorite sauce will make this lasagna your own! If you don't have pasta sauce, some diced tomatoes, extra garlic, and some seasoning will work just as well. Just be sure to match the volume of liquid (since the noodles will literally cook in the sauce)
If I have Italian sausage, I might use half ground beef, half sausage.
If you like a little heat, some red pepper flakes are a lovely addition (add them with the Italian Seasoning)
